Summary:

The city of Beverly, Massachusetts is home to a single high school, Beverly High School, which serves students in grades 9-12. The school has maintained a relatively stable 3-star rating from SchoolDigger over the past few years, ranking 172 out of 349 Massachusetts high schools for the 2024-2025 school year.

Beverly High School's academic performance is generally above the state average, with a 4-year graduation rate of 91.1% and a dropout rate of 3.0% for the 2023-2024 school year. However, the school's proficiency rates on the MCAS Next Generation assessments have declined slightly from the previous year, with 46.55% in English Language Arts, 40.35% in Mathematics, and 49.64% in Science for 10th-grade students in the 2024-2025 school year. The school's per-student spending for the 2020-2021 school year was $15,302, and its student-teacher ratio of 12.2 is lower than the state average.

While Beverly High School appears to be a solid performer, there are some areas, such as academic proficiency, that could benefit from further analysis and improvement efforts. The school's performance, when compared to the overall Beverly school district and the state of Massachusetts, suggests that the school may need to focus on aligning its core academic offerings to better meet district and state standards.
